Full Job Description
Overview

The Combat Weapons Systems (CWS) Facility Management Group is responsible for development and maintenance of hotel services provided within all of the CWS laboratory facilities. This includes collecting requirements from Lab and Integration teams to validate requirements and working with EB facilities, EB security, government contractors etc. to implement them. In this position the candidate will be a Test Engineer and will perform duties as a D448 Lab Manager.

 

The candidate will support technical resolutions for a variety of complex construction issues for VIRGINIA & COLUMBIA Class Submarines. This job will require investigation/evaluation of units and modules under various stages of construction. The majority of work will be centered on supporting system operational testing, test execution, and evaluation of results while maintaining a prototypical hardware and software development lab. You will work with system engineers, deck plate technicians, government program offices, vendors and military personnel for delivered submarines in support of engineering efforts that will extend to the analysis and resolution of fleet identified problems, assessment of obsolescence issues, and implementation of modernization programs.

 

The candidate will be responsible for working with facilities and vendors to perform repairs and normal maintenance on AC, power and other aspects of a protypical lab. Additionally, working with EB Security to ensure physical security policies are being met for the building. This includes tasks like communicating to EB Fire to disable sensors floor tiles to complete a job; working with EB IT to have new network or power drops installed within an area of a lab; ensuring the proper security markings are placed on items being shipped out of the building; arranging pickup and drop off of equipment with EB transportation and other vendors used; organizing and completing material sightings required for Special Property requirements.

 

The candidate will provide status reports and metrics to management and/or the customer as needed. They will develop status and analyze department specific integrated project schedules to support task planning, identify conflicts and support status efforts to help ensure timely project completion.

 

This position may require an occasional 2nd shift depending on department needs.
